2022-03917, 2023-10429 U.S. Bank, National Association, etc., respondent, v John Faracco, appellant, et al., defendants. (Index No. 23325/2012)
| ORDER TO SHOW CAUSE |
Appeals from an order of the Supreme Court, Suffolk County, dated April 20, 2022, and an order and judgment (one paper) of the same court dated July 20, 2023. Motion by the respondent to dismiss the appeal from the order on the ground that the right of direct appeal from the order terminated upon entry of the order and judgment, and to dismiss the appeal from the order and judgment on the ground that the order and judgment was entered upon the default of the appealing party. By decision and order on motion of this Court dated February 9, 2024, the appellant was directed to serve and file replacement digital copies of the appendix and briefs which contain Appellate Division Docket No. 2023-10429 in addition to Appellate Division Docket No. 2022-03917 on the covers, and a supplemental appendix containing the order and judgment and the notice of appeal from the order and judgment via NYSCEF, on or before March 11, 2024. The appellant has not filed the replacement appendix and briefs or supplemental appendix.
Upon the papers filed in support of the motion and no papers having been filed in opposition or in relation thereto, it is
ORDERED that on the Court's own motion, the parties to the appeals are directed to show cause before this Court why an order should or should not be made and entered dismissing the appeals in the above-entitled action for failure to comply with the decision and order on motion of this Court dated February 9, 2024, by uploading a digital copy of an affirmation or an affidavit on that issue, via NYSCEF, on or before August 16, 2024; if the appellant be so advised, the appellant may make a motion via NYSCEF, on or before August 16, 2024, for any relief deemed appropriate; and it is further,
ORDERED that the motion by respondent is held in abeyance in the interim; and it is further,
ORDERED that the Clerk of this Court, or his designee, is directed to serve a copy of this order to show cause upon the parties by uploading a copy of this order to show cause to the NYSCEF system.
DUFFY, J.P., MALTESE, DOWLING and LOVE, JJ., concur.
